Clean Room

Clean rooms are controlled environments essential for maintaining sterility and minimizing contamination in laboratory settings. They regulate temperature, humidity, and air quality to ensure that sensitive processes, such as cell culture, pharmaceutical manufacturing, and microelectronics production, occur in a contaminant-free environment. Clean rooms are equipped with HEPA filters, controlled airflow, and strict access protocols to maintain low levels of particulates and microorganisms. These environments are critical for applications requiring the highest standards of cleanliness and precision in research and production.
